There is another decisive reason.


The 501 wasn’t originally “a garment for talking about shape.”


Making your legs look better, making your figure look better,

That way of thinking came later.


What was being asked for was,

That you could squat in them.

That they wouldn’t tear.

The ability to produce them quickly and in large quantities.


That’s all.


And still, now, we

Yet we overlay our ideal image of its silhouette onto it.


By this point, we’re no longer talking about the same thing.



That is why,

Conversations about the 501 are always misaligned.

First.

An ideal 501 cut that could never exist.


This,

A 501 someone has imagined at least once in their mind.


It settles strangely well when worn at the waist.

Wide, yet never dowdy.

Relaxed, yet never sloppy.


But,

was a shape that never existed as a finished garment.is.


The 501 of that era, before it could be refined to that extent,

They were sent out into the realities of production.


Shrinkage rates were not consistent.

No body types were taken into consideration.

Sizing was rough, with considerable variation between individual pieces.


That is why this cut is not a reproduction of vintage.


ignoring all the constraints of the time,

“If we were to create the idea of the 501 from scratch today,”

lines redrawn on the assumption that


While retaining the reassurance of the 501,

yet it is somehow too convenient.


Precisely because it never existed,

The image that has been talked about for so long

A shape once brought down to realityis.
